Sternoclavicular Arthroscopy

Procedures on the sternoclavicular joint are not common, and arthroscopy of the joint has only been reported sparsely. The advantage of arthroscopic procedures in this joint is the full visualization of the joint cavity, including the posterior capsule, which must not be perforated. There are two standard portals and a 2.9 mm scope is used. Morbidity is low. It is possible to do resection of the intra-articular disc, resection of the medial clavicular end, removal of loose bodies, and synovectomy of the joint. Results are comparable to what is obtained by open techniques.
